Package: openoffice.org Version: 1.1.2-3 Severity: normal Whenever I open a document in OOo to print it, the document is marked as modified afterwards, and when I later want to close the document, I get a prompt if I want to save or discard my changes, only I haven't made any changes. I have only printed the document.
It seems rather counterintuitive that printing a document should modify it. At least I find it hard to understand.
